Banff National Park
A Nature Lover’s Paradise
Nestled in the heart of the Canadian Rockies, Banff National Park is a pristine wilderness that beckons nature enthusiasts from around the world. With its towering mountains, crystal-clear lakes, and abundant wildlife, this UNESCO World Heritage Site offers a multitude of outdoor adventures.
Begin your exploration by immersing yourself in the awe-inspiring beauty of Lake Louise. Surrounded by snow-capped peaks, this turquoise gem is a hiker’s paradise. Lace up your boots and embark on a trail that winds through alpine meadows, revealing panoramic vistas at every turn.
For a more challenging adventure, head to Moraine Lake, often referred to as the “Jewel of the Rockies.” Hike to the top of the Rockpile, where you’ll be rewarded with a breathtaking view of the lake and the Valley of the Ten Peaks. The vibrant blue waters juxtaposed against the towering mountains create a picturesque scene that will leave you speechless.
Outdoor Activities for All Seasons
Banff National Park offers a plethora of outdoor activities throughout the year. In the winter, hit the slopes at one of the world-class ski resorts, such as Sunshine Village or Lake Louise Ski Resort. Feel the rush as you carve through the fresh powder, surrounded by a winter wonderland.
During the summer months, the park transforms into a playground for hikers, mountain bikers, and wildlife enthusiasts. Explore the extensive network of trails that cater to all skill levels, from leisurely strolls to challenging multi-day hikes. Keep your camera handy as you may encounter majestic elk, bighorn sheep, or even elusive grizzly bears.
Niagara Falls
Awe-Inspiring Natural Wonder
One of the most iconic natural wonders in the world, Niagara Falls is a must-visit destination that will leave you mesmerized. Witness the sheer power and beauty of the falls as millions of gallons of water cascade over the edge every minute.
Start your visit with a thrilling boat ride on the Hornblower Niagara Cruises. Don a provided poncho and get up close and personal with the falls as you sail through the mist and feel the thundering roar of the water. The experience is truly exhilarating and offers a unique perspective of this magnificent wonder.
Exploring the Surrounding Area
While Niagara Falls is undoubtedly the main attraction, the surrounding area has much to offer. Take a leisurely stroll along the Niagara Parkway, a scenic drive that offers stunning views of the Niagara River and its gorge. Stop by the Floral Clock, a masterpiece of horticulture, or visit the charming town of Niagara-on-the-Lake, known for its quaint shops, wineries, and historic charm.
If you’re feeling adventurous, embark on a helicopter tour for a bird’s-eye view of the falls and the surrounding landscape. The aerial perspective allows you to fully grasp the grandeur of this natural wonder, offering a once-in-a-lifetime experience.
Vancouver
A Harmonious Blend of Urban Living and Natural Beauty
Vancouver, a vibrant city on the west coast of Canada, seamlessly combines the excitement of urban living with the serenity of natural beauty. Surrounded by mountains and the Pacific Ocean, this city offers a plethora of outdoor activities and cultural experiences.
Start your exploration by visiting Stanley Park, a sprawling urban oasis that boasts stunning views, lush forests, and a vibrant waterfront. Rent a bike and cycle along the seawall, or take a leisurely stroll through the park’s picturesque trails. Don’t miss the iconic Totem Poles, which offer a glimpse into the rich Indigenous history of the region.
The Vibrant Neighborhoods of Vancouver
Vancouver is renowned for its diverse neighborhoods, each with its own unique charm and character. Visit Granville Island, a vibrant hub of artisans, food vendors, and theaters. Explore the Public Market, where you can indulge in fresh local produce, gourmet treats, and handmade crafts.
For a taste of Asia in North America, head to Vancouver’s historic Chinatown. Wander through the bustling streets, adorned with colorful traditional architecture and an array of shops and restaurants. Don’t forget to try some of the delicious dim sum or sip on a refreshing bubble tea.
Quebec City
A Step Back in Time
Quebec City, the capital of the province of Quebec, is a charming destination that offers a unique blend of history and culture. As you wander through the cobblestone streets of Old Quebec, you’ll feel like you’ve been transported to a bygone era.
Start your exploration at Place Royale, the birthplace of French civilization in North America. Admire the beautifully restored historic buildings that line the square, including the iconic Notre-Dame-des-Victoires Church. Take a moment to soak in the atmosphere as you enjoy a cup of coffee at one of the quaint sidewalk cafes.
Immersing in French-Inspired Charm
Quebec City is renowned for its French-inspired architecture and culinary delights. Stroll along Rue du Petit-Champlain, a picturesque street lined with boutiques, art galleries, and charming cafes. Indulge in a mouthwatering meal at one of the city’s many French restaurants, where you can savor classic dishes like poutine or tourtière.
For a panoramic view of the city, head to the historic Plains of Abraham. This vast urban park offers stunning vistas of the St. Lawrence River and is the site of the famous Battle of Quebec. Take a leisurely walk or have a picnic on the grassy plains, embracing the tranquility and beauty of this historic site.
Jasper National Park
A Wilderness Playground
Jasper National Park, the largest national park in the Canadian Rockies, is a haven for outdoor enthusiasts seeking untouched wilderness and breathtaking landscapes. With its rugged mountains, glaciers, and turquoise lakes, this park offers endless opportunities for adventure.
Begin your exploration by visiting the Columbia Icefield, one of the largest ice fields in North America. Hop aboard an Ice Explorer and venture onto the Athabasca Glacier, where you can walk on ancient ice and learn about the fascinating geological history of the region.
Wildlife Spotting and Scenic Hikes
Jasper National Park is home to a diverse range of wildlife, including bears, elk, and moose. Embark on a wildlife tour or simply keep your eyes peeled as you explore the park’s network of hiking trails. The Maligne Lake area is particularly popular for wildlife sightings, so be sure to bring your binoculars and camera.
For those seeking a more challenging adventure, consider hiking the Skyline Trail. This multi-day trek offers breathtaking views of the surrounding mountains and valleys, as well as the opportunity to spot wildlife along the way. Remember to come prepared with proper gear and a sense of adventure.
Toronto
The Dynamic Heart of Canada
Toronto, Canada’s largest city, is a vibrant metropolis that offers a dynamic cultural scene, world-class shopping, and iconic landmarks. From soaring skyscrapers to diverse neighborhoods, there is something for everyone in this cosmopolitan city.
Start your exploration by visiting the iconic CN Tower, one of the world’s tallest freestanding structures. Take a ride to the top and enjoy panoramic views of the city and Lake Ontario. For the thrill-seekers, try the EdgeWalk, a hands-free walk on a ledge that encircles the tower’s main pod.
Neighborhoods and Culinary Delights
Toronto is a melting pot of cultures, and each neighborhood offers its own unique charm and culinary delights. Visit Kensington Market, a vibrant and eclectic neighborhood known for its bohemian vibe and diverse street food. Sample flavors from around the world as you wander through the colorful streets filled with vintage shops and independent boutiques.
For a glimpse into Toronto’s rich history, head to the Distillery District. This pedestrian-only village is renowned for its beautifully preserved Victorian-era buildings that now house art galleries, boutiques, and restaurants. Enjoy a craft cocktail at one of the local distilleries or indulge in a delicious meal at a rooftop patio.
Prince Edward Island
A Coastal Gem in the Atlantic
Prince Edward Island, located on the country’s eastern coast, is a picturesque destination known for its stunning coastal beauty and charming small towns. With its red sand beaches, rolling green hills, and quaint lighthouses, this island is a hidden gem waiting to be explored.
Begin your journey by visiting Cavendish Beach, a pristine stretch of coastline that inspired Lucy Maud Montgomery’s famous novel, “Anne of Green Gables.” Take a leisurely strollalong the white sands, breathe in the fresh ocean air, and immerse yourself in the natural beauty that surrounds you. If you’re feeling adventurous, try your hand at clam digging or beachcombing for unique seashells and treasures.
Indulging in Fresh Seafood and Island Delights
Prince Edward Island is renowned for its delectable seafood, particularly its world-famous lobster. Don’t miss the opportunity to savor a traditional lobster feast, where you can crack open fresh lobster claws and indulge in the succulent meat. Pair it with locally grown potatoes, known for their exceptional flavor, and you have a true taste of the island.
While on the island, be sure to visit the charming capital city of Charlottetown. Explore the historic streets, lined with colorful Victorian homes and quaint shops. Visit the Confederation Centre of the Arts, where you can immerse yourself in the cultural heritage of the island through art exhibitions and live performances.
Whistler
A Winter Wonderland
Renowned as a premier ski destination, Whistler attracts visitors from all over the world with its world-class slopes and breathtaking scenery. Nestled in the Coast Mountains of British Columbia, this winter wonderland offers an abundance of activities for snow enthusiasts of all levels.
Hit the slopes and experience the thrill of skiing or snowboarding on Whistler Blackcomb, one of North America’s largest ski resorts. With over 8,000 acres of skiable terrain, there is something for everyone, from gentle beginner slopes to challenging expert runs. Admire the panoramic views as you glide down the mountain, surrounded by towering peaks and pristine forests.
Year-Round Outdoor Adventures
Whistler isn’t just a winter destination; it offers a wealth of outdoor activities throughout the year. In the summer months, explore the vast network of hiking and biking trails that wind through the mountains. Take a leisurely stroll through the alpine meadows, or challenge yourself with a challenging hike to one of the many scenic viewpoints.
For the adrenaline junkies, try your hand at zip-lining through the treetops or experience the thrill of whitewater rafting on the nearby rivers. Golf enthusiasts will be delighted with Whistler’s championship golf courses, offering stunning views and challenging holes amidst the natural beauty of the mountains.
Tofino
A Coastal Haven
Tofino, located on the rugged west coast of Vancouver Island, is a haven for surfers, nature lovers, and those seeking tranquility amidst breathtaking scenery. With its pristine beaches, ancient rainforests, and abundant wildlife, Tofino offers a truly immersive and rejuvenating experience.
Start your exploration by visiting Pacific Rim National Park Reserve, a UNESCO Biosphere Reserve that showcases the region’s stunning natural beauty. Take a leisurely stroll along the sandy shores of Long Beach, where you can watch the crashing waves and spot surfers riding the swell. Keep an eye out for wildlife, as bald eagles soar above and seals frolic in the surf.
Outdoor Adventures and Culinary Delights
Tofino is renowned as a surfing hotspot, attracting wave enthusiasts from around the world. Whether you’re a seasoned pro or a beginner looking to catch your first wave, Tofino’s sandy beaches offer ideal conditions for both. Join a surf lesson or simply relax on the beach and soak up the laid-back vibes of this coastal paradise.
After a day of adventure, indulge in the culinary delights that Tofino has to offer. Known for its fresh seafood, the town boasts an array of restaurants that serve up delectable dishes using locally sourced ingredients. Treat yourself to a feast of Dungeness crab, spot prawns, or succulent salmon, paired with a glass of British Columbia’s finest wine.
Montreal
A Vibrant Cultural Hub
Immerse yourself in the vibrant culture and rich history of Montreal, the largest city in the province of Quebec. With its European charm, diverse neighborhoods, and lively festivals, Montreal offers a unique and captivating experience.
Begin your exploration in Old Montreal, the historic heart of the city. Wander through the cobblestone streets and marvel at the beautifully preserved architecture that reflects the city’s French heritage. Visit the magnificent Notre-Dame Basilica, a masterpiece of Gothic Revival architecture, and learn about the city’s fascinating history at the Pointe-à-Callière Museum.
A Feast for the Senses
Montreal is renowned for its culinary scene, which offers a fusion of French and international flavors. Indulge in poutine, a classic Canadian dish of french fries topped with cheese curds and smothered in gravy, or treat yourself to a steaming plate of smoked meat at Schwartz’s Deli, a Montreal institution since 1928.
For a taste of the city’s multiculturalism, explore the vibrant neighborhoods of Little Italy and Chinatown. Sample authentic Italian pastries or savor dim sum at one of the many Chinese restaurants. Montreal’s food scene is constantly evolving, so be sure to keep an eye out for the latest culinary trends and hidden gems.
